Transaction d71e66042222c647cc394b222a9bdab3496c49102b2ae10f7af5539a6c962995

1 Input
2 Outputs
  • d71e66042222c647cc394b222a9bdab3496c49102b2ae10f7af5539a6c962995:0
  • value  447584
    address  3DtuhvAibFtZAgwEEsKdLfMDJDscgr5oti
  • d71e66042222c647cc394b222a9bdab3496c49102b2ae10f7af5539a6c962995:1
  • value  4137560
    address  1GhAAXP7ZGdSFkiYwzwfmvCma9jAuVsDLE